<DOCTYPE html!> <Html> <head> <meta charset = "UTF-8"> <title> XXX联系方式</ title> <meta name = "viewport" content = "width = dispositivo de ancho; inicial escala = 1,0 "> <link rel =" stylesheet "href = "https://cdn.jsdelivr.net/npm/[email protected]/dist/css/bootstrap.min.css" integridad =" SHA384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va + PmSTsz / K68vbdEjh4u" crossorigin = "Anónimo"> <style> . º mesa { texto -align: centro; fuente -size: 18px; verticales -align: medio! importante; } . tabla td { fuente -tamaño:16px; verticales -align: medio! importante; } H2 {font -peso: bold; text-align: center;} </ style> </ head> <body> <h2> XXX联系方式</ h2> <table clase = "bordeado-mesa"> <thead > <tr> <th>序号</ th> <th>姓名</ th> <th>操作</ th> </ tr> </ thead> <tbody> < ? php $ conn = mysqli_connect ( '127.0.0.1', 'root', 'root', 'mesa') o mueren( 'Error de conexión:'. Mysqli_error ()); // establecer la codificación, la distorsión china prevenir la mysqli_query ( $ Conn , "nombres UTF8" ); $ SQL = "SELECT * FROM TB_NLianXiFS ID del pedido por ASC ' ; $ retval = la mysqli_query ( $ Conn , $ SQL ) o Die ( "Error en la consulta: $ SQL .". mysql_error ()); al mismo tiempo ( $ fila = mysqli_fetch_assoc ( $ retval )) { echo '<TR>' ; echo '<td align = "centro">'. $ fila [ 'id'] '</ td>'. ; echo '<td>'. $ fila [ 'nombre'] '</ td>'. ; echo '<td> <tipo botón = "botón" class = "btn btn-éxito" onclick = "Calltel ('. $ fila [ 'tel']. ');"> & nbsp;拨号& nbsp; </ button> < / td>' ; eco "</ tr>" ; } Mysqli_free_result ( $ retval ); $ ip = getip (); $ rq = fecha ( "Ymd h: i: s" ); $ InsertSQL= "En tb_njlb (ip, RIQI) Inserte valores ( ' $ ip ', ' $ rq ')" ; $ resultado = mysqli_query ( $ conn , $ InsertSQL ) o troquel ( "Error en Query". mysql_error ()); mysqli_close ( $ conn ); ?> </ Tbody> </ table> <script type = "text / javascript"> función Calltel (tel) { ventana .location.href = "tel:" + tel; } </ Script> </ body> </ html> <? php función getip () { si ( $ _SERVER [ "HTTP_CLIENT_IP"] && strcasecmp ( $ _SERVER [ "HTTP_CLIENT_IP"], "desconocido" )) { $ ip = $ _SERVER [ "HTTP_CLIENT_IP" ]; } Demás { si ( $ _SERVER [ "HTTP_X_FORWARDED_FOR"] && strcasecmp ( $ _SERVER [ "HTTP_X_FORWARDED_FOR"], "desconocido" )) { $ ip = $ _SERVER [ "HTTP_X_FORWARDED_FOR" ];$ _SERVER [ "REMOTE_ADDR"] && strcasecmp ( $ _SERVER [ "REMOTE_ADDR"], "desconocido" )) { $ ip = $ _SERVER [ "REMOTE_ADDR" ]; } Demás { si ( isset ( $ _SERVER [ 'REMOTE_ADDR']) && $ _SERVER [ 'REMOTE_ADDR'] && strcasecmp ( $ _SERVER [ 'REMOTE_ADDR'], "desconocido" ) ) { $ ip = $ _SERVER [ 'REMOTE_ADDR' ] ;{ $ Ip = "desconocido" ; } } } } Retorno ( $ ip ); } ?>